Awarded “Best Hotel in Venice” and ranked among the Top 20 Hotels in the World by Condé Nast Traveller (2025), this majestic resort immerses guests in a 900-year-old historic building, rich in charm and Renaissance tradition. It features a collection of beautifully restored monastic structures, a 12th-century chapel, and nearly 6 hectares of ancient gardens offering breathtaking views of the city, along with 196 meticulously furnished rooms and suites, including the largest and most exclusive suite in Venice.
Annual art installations rotate throughout the property in conjunction with the Venice Biennale. Inside, the hotel seamlessly blends contemporary style with Renaissance influences, boasting six-meter-high ceilings, wide corridors, grand staircases, and intricate details such as terrazzo floors, silk-covered walls, and Murano glass chandeliers, making it one of Europe’s premier hotels for art exhibitions.
Serenity permeates the hotel’s Longevity Spa, which features a heated outdoor pool, tennis court, jogging paths, a pitch & putt golf course, and a fully equipped kids’ club – ensuring an unforgettable stay.
The hotel’s proximity to St. Mark’s Square, its exceptional culinary offerings, and its unique combination of indoor and outdoor venues invite guests to create truly memorable experiences.
